Nursing Homes in South Dakota

96 Medicare-certified nursing homes across 71 cities

96

Total Facilities

71

Cities Covered

96

Medicare Certified

3.9

Avg Google Rating

Finding a Nursing Home in South Dakota

South Dakota has 96 Medicare-certified nursing homes and skilled nursing facilities across 71 cities and towns. Whether you're looking for short-term rehabilitation after a hospital stay or long-term care for a loved one, this directory helps you compare facilities by CMS star ratings, Google reviews, staffing levels, and health inspection records.

The largest concentration of nursing homes in South Dakota is in Rapid City, with 8 facilities. Use the city listings below to find nursing homes near you, or search by zip code for the closest options.

Browse by City in South Dakota

Rapid City

8 nursing homes

Sioux Falls

7 nursing homes

Aberdeen

4 nursing homes

Brookings

2 nursing homes

Flandreau

2 nursing homes

Hot Springs

2 nursing homes

Milbank

2 nursing homes

Mitchell

2 nursing homes

Pierre

2 nursing homes

Redfield

2 nursing homes

Watertown

2 nursing homes

Yankton

2 nursing homes

Alcester

1 nursing home

Belle Fourche

1 nursing home

Beresford

1 nursing home

Bowdle

1 nursing home

Brandon

1 nursing home

Bridgewater

1 nursing home

Bristol

1 nursing home

Britton

1 nursing home

Canistota

1 nursing home

Canton

1 nursing home

Centerville

1 nursing home

Chamberlain

1 nursing home

Clark

1 nursing home

Corsica

1 nursing home

Custer

1 nursing home

De Smet

1 nursing home

Dell Rapids

1 nursing home

Eagle Butte

1 nursing home

Estelline

1 nursing home

Eureka

1 nursing home

Faulkton

1 nursing home

Freeman

1 nursing home

Garretson

1 nursing home

Gettysburg

1 nursing home

Gregory

1 nursing home

Groton

1 nursing home

Highmore

1 nursing home

Howard

1 nursing home

Huron

1 nursing home

Irene

1 nursing home

Kadoka

1 nursing home

Lake Andes

1 nursing home

Lake Norden

1 nursing home

Lemmon

1 nursing home

Madison

1 nursing home

Marion

1 nursing home

Menno

1 nursing home

Miller

1 nursing home

New Underwood

1 nursing home

Parkston

1 nursing home

Philip

1 nursing home

Platte

1 nursing home

Roslyn

1 nursing home

Scotland

1 nursing home

Selby

1 nursing home

Sisseton

1 nursing home

Spearfish

1 nursing home

Sturgis

1 nursing home

Tyndall

1 nursing home

Vermillion

1 nursing home

Viborg

1 nursing home

Wakonda

1 nursing home

Webster

1 nursing home

Wessington Springs

1 nursing home

White Lake

1 nursing home

White River

1 nursing home

Wilmot

1 nursing home

Winner

1 nursing home

Woonsocket

1 nursing home

Frequently Asked Questions

How many nursing homes are in South Dakota?

South Dakota has 96 Medicare-certified nursing homes and skilled nursing facilities across 71 cities.

Does Medicare cover nursing home care in South Dakota?

Medicare Part A covers short-term skilled nursing facility care in South Dakota after a qualifying 3-day hospital stay — typically up to 100 days. Long-term custodial care is generally not covered by Medicare and requires Medicaid or private pay.

How do I compare nursing home quality in South Dakota?

CMS rates every Medicare-certified nursing home in South Dakota on a 1–5 star scale based on health inspections, staffing levels, and quality measures. You can compare these ratings alongside Google reviews for each facility on this site.

What is the average cost of a nursing home in South Dakota?

Nursing home costs vary by location and level of care. Semi-private rooms typically range from $200–$350/day. Medicaid covers nursing home care for eligible residents once personal assets are spent down to qualifying levels.